I adopted chip a week ago in hopes he was young enough to learn to get along with my cat. His prey drive is too high and I dont see it working out. I WILL PROVIDE TOYS, REMAINDER OF HIS FOOD, HARNESS, SLOW FEEDER BOWL AND WATER DISHES, AND ANY OTHER BELONGINGS OF HIS. He is a good dog who is learning tricks fast and walking better on a leash every day. He learned to be house trained very fast. He was abandoned at a shelter tied to a fence before I adopted him so I want him to properly be rehomed. He is totally fine with sleeping with you all the time and also fine with energetic activities. He is in the works for crate training but with time I definitely see it being possible. I cant safely let him be with my cat so he needs a new home without cats. He loves chewing bones and stuffed toys.
